#44a850 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#44a850 is composed of 26.7% red, 65.9%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.4%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 127.2 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 46.3%. #44a850 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ffa0 with #005100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#44a850 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#44a850 has RGB values of R:68, G:168,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 4499536.

Shades and Tints of #44a850
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1faf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#44a850
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717b72 is the less saturated color, while #04e820 is the most saturated one.
